Market Overview

The Global Packaged Burgers Market will grow from USD 4.48 Billion in 2025 to USD 7.08 Billion by 2031 at a 7.93% CAGR. Packaged burgers are defined as pre-formed raw or cooked patties composed of minced meat, poultry, or plant-based ingredients that are processed, sealed, and distributed in frozen or refrigerated formats for retail and foodservice sectors. The market is primarily propelled by the escalating consumer demand for convenient, time-saving meal solutions and the expanding reach of modern grocery retail channels which ensure consistent product availability. This expansion is underpinned by a sustained appetite for protein staples, as evidenced by robust category performance in major markets. According to the 'Meat Institute', in '2025', 'meat volume sales in the United States increased by 2.3% in 2024 compared to the prior year, contributing to a record $104.6 billion in total sales'.

However, the sector faces a significant hurdle regarding supply chain volatility and the high operational costs associated with maintaining cold chain integrity. The stringent temperature requirements necessary to preserve product safety and quality during transport and storage create substantial logistical expenses that can erode profit margins, particularly in emerging regions where temperature-controlled infrastructure remains developing.

Key Market Drivers

The rising demand for convenience and ready-to-cook meals is a primary force propelling the Global Packaged Burgers Market, as time-pressed consumers increasingly favor versatile protein options that simplify home cooking. This trend is anchored by the enduring popularity of ground meat products, which serve as the foundation for the retail burger category and offer cost-effective, easy-to-prepare dinner solutions. According to the Meat Institute, March 2025, in the 'Power of Meat 2025' report, ground beef accounted for 85% of total sales within the ground meat category in 2024, reflecting its unmatched status as a convenience staple. This high volume of consumption directly supports the expansion of pre-formed packaged burger formats, which further reduce preparation time for dual-income households and urban dwellers.

Simultaneously, the market is being reshaped by a growing consumer preference for plant-based and vegan alternatives, expanding the sector's reach to flexitarians and environmentally conscious shoppers. Innovations in texture and flavor have allowed non-meat patties to secure a significant footprint in international retail channels, creating a lucrative parallel segment. According to the Good Food Institute, May 2025, in the '2024 State of the Industry' report, global retail sales of plant-based meat and seafood rose 4% to $6.1 billion in 2024, demonstrating the category's global resilience. This diversification occurs within a highly penetrated overall market; according to the Food Industry Association (FMI), in 2025, the household penetration rate for meat and poultry remained at 98.2%, ensuring a massive, stabilized consumer base for both traditional and alternative burger innovations.

Key Market Challenges

The Global Packaged Burgers Market faces a formidable obstacle in the form of supply chain volatility and the elevated operational costs required to maintain cold chain integrity. Whether composed of meat or plant-based ingredients, packaged burgers necessitate strict temperature controls throughout their storage and distribution to prevent spoilage and ensure food safety. This dependency makes the sector highly vulnerable to fluctuations in logistics expenses, including energy prices for refrigeration, warehousing rents, and specialized transportation costs. When these input costs rise, manufacturers often struggle to absorb the expenses, leading to reduced profitability or the necessity of passing costs to consumers, which can negatively affect sales volume.

The impact of these rising logistical burdens is evident in recent industry data. According to the 'Global Cold Chain Alliance', in '2025', 'total cold storage costs increased by 4.97% in the first quarter compared to the same period in the previous year'. This escalating financial pressure, driven by higher labor and facility rental rates, directly hampers market growth by eroding margins and limiting the capital available for market expansion in developing regions where cold chain infrastructure is already capital-intensive to establish.

Key Market Trends

The Proliferation of Gourmet and Premium Meat Blend Varieties is reshaping the sector as consumers increasingly seek restaurant-quality dining experiences at home. Retailers and processors are responding by introducing high-end patty formulations that utilize specific cuts, such as brisket, short rib, or Wagyu blends, to differentiate from commoditized ground meat. This premiumization strategy not only caters to the demand for superior texture and flavor but also supports volume growth in a competitive retail landscape. According to Hilton Food Group, April 2025, in the '2024 Annual Report', the company delivered solid volume growth of 4.4% across all regions in 2024, a performance significantly supported by product improvement and the expansion of its premium tier ranges.

Simultaneously, the widespread Adoption of Sustainable and Smart Packaging Technologies is being driven by stringent environmental goals and the need to reduce food waste. Manufacturers are heavily capitalizing on operational upgrades to integrate recyclable materials and advanced vacuum-skin formats that extend shelf life while lowering carbon footprints. This capital-intensive shift is evident in the investment strategies of leading industry players aiming to meet aggressive sustainability targets. According to Cargill, January 2025, in the '2024 Impact Report', the company invested $100 million in efficiency and sustainability capital projects within its operations during the fiscal year 2024, reflecting the sector's tangible commitment to minimizing environmental impact.

Segmental Insights

The Online segment is currently recognized as the fastest growing distribution channel within the Global Packaged Burgers Market. This rapid expansion is primarily driven by the increasing consumer demand for convenience and the substantial proliferation of e-commerce platforms. As modern lifestyles become more hectic, shoppers are shifting towards digital storefronts that offer broader product assortments, including niche plant-based and gourmet options not always available in physical retail. Furthermore, major retailers are enhancing their logistics and cold-chain capabilities to ensure product freshness upon delivery, thereby boosting consumer confidence in purchasing frozen and chilled burgers online.

Regional Insights

North America maintains a dominant position in the Global Packaged Burgers Market due to widespread consumer preference for convenient, frozen, and chilled meat products. The region features a developed retail sector and efficient cold chain systems that facilitate broad distribution throughout the United States and Canada. Furthermore, rigorous safety protocols overseen by the United States Department of Agriculture ensure high product quality and consumer trust in meat processing. These factors, combined with a strong cultural affinity for burger consumption and busy lifestyles, firmly establish the region as the global market leader.

Recent Developments

  • In April 2025, Tyson Foods expanded its foodservice portfolio with the introduction of four new protein products, including "Fully Cooked Flamebroiled Turkey Patties." These new patties were developed to offer a char-grilled flavor profile and a convenient, high-protein option for operators catering to health-conscious diners. The company highlighted that these turkey burgers contained significantly less fat than standard beef patties while retaining a premium taste and texture. This launch leveraged consumer insights indicating a rising preference for poultry as a healthy protein source. By providing a ready-to-heat solution that minimized preparation time, the company aimed to support foodservice establishments in delivering consistent quality and meeting the growing demand for lighter burger alternatives.
  • In September 2024, Iceland Foods executed a major expansion of its product portfolio by launching over 800 new items, which included significant additions to its packaged burger offerings. The frozen food specialist introduced "XL Hash Brown Cheeseburgers" and extended its exclusive partnership range with TGI Fridays to include "Hash Brown Cheeseburgers." These launches were part of a broader innovation push driven by customer feedback and a desire to provide "fake-away" style meal solutions that replicate restaurant flavors at home. By diversifying its frozen patty selection with these indulgent, value-added options, the retailer sought to strengthen its appeal to consumers seeking convenient, comfort-food meal solutions amidst a competitive retail landscape.
  • In May 2024, Beyond Meat commenced the retail rollout of its fourth-generation plant-based beef products, specifically the new iteration of its flagship burger and beef mince. This updated formulation, marketed as the "Beyond IV" platform, incorporated avocado oil to significantly reduce saturated fat content while maintaining a meat-like texture and flavor. The company positioned this launch as a pivotal move to address consumer health concerns, highlighting that the new patties offered a nutritional profile comparable to or better than traditional animal beef. This strategic product renovation was intended to reverse declining sales trends by delivering a superior sensory experience and cleaner ingredient list to health-conscious shoppers in major grocery chains.
  • In April 2024, Waitrose introduced a comprehensive summer food range featuring innovative packaged meat products designed to align with evolving consumer culinary trends. Among the standout launches were beef smash burgers enriched with bone marrow, created to offer a premium, restaurant-style dining experience at home. This product development was reportedly influenced by artificial intelligence analysis of social media and customer insights, which identified a growing demand for high-quality, indulgent convenience foods. The retailer aimed to cater to spontaneous dining occasions by offering these specialized burger patties alongside other unique items like New York-style hot dogs, enhancing their competitive position in the premium retail frozen and chilled category.
